Nestled in the heart of North Warwickshire, Atherstone is a picturesque market town that beautifully balances historic character with contemporary living. With its quaint high street, lined with independent shops, cafés, and traditional pubs, Atherstone offers a warm and welcoming community atmosphere.
Atherstone is ideally located for commuters, with excellent transport links via the A5, M42, and nearby M6. The town's railway station offers direct services to Birmingham, Nuneaton, and beyond, making it a perfect base for those working in the Midlands.
Families are well-served by a selection of reputable local schools, both primary and secondary, and the surrounding countryside offers a wealth of outdoor activities, from scenic walks along the Coventry Canal to exploring the nearby Hartshill Hayes Country Park.
